Output 83c59a07c0a74a82375406054f674975a39d9e2744a0e0d623542b32b3e8084e:3

value
1447597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 114aecdec6ea1c530e2a723779147f8804ece1ef OP_EQUAL
address
33GTAhoAd9chL3oz3SD3X4bV7J5sZtSNdP
transaction
83c59a07c0a74a82375406054f674975a39d9e2744a0e0d623542b32b3e8084e
spent
true